Hi NetPals, NetPlace is coming to NetSciX 2026 at the University of Auckland, New Zealand. We will organize a panel discussion on Beyond Isolation: Getting Connected in Network Science on February 17, 2026, starting from 17:30 local time.

The discussion will focus on the forms of isolation that young as well as senior researchers may face, including geographic, cultural, financial, and institutional barriers, and will aim to offer practical ways to reduce isolation, as well as a networking opportunity for participants.

We are thrilled to have Akrati Saxena, Roland Molontay and Natalia Albert Llorente as our panelists, who will share their personal experience insights regarding the isolation and possible solutions.
